This beautifully written text makes statistics accessible to students through the use of integrated narratives and wide-ranging examples. A refreshing text that emphasizes the link between research design and statistical analysis, it also promotes graphic literacy, and offers guidelines on how to report results.

SUSAN A. NOLAN is Associate Dean of Graduate Studies for the College of Arts and Sciences, as well as an Associate Professor of Psychology, at Seton Hall University, New Jersey, USA. She has served as a statistical consultant to researchers at several universities, medical schools, corporations, and non-governmental organizations. THOMAS E. HEINZEN is based at William Paterson State University, New Jersey, USA. He has been awarded various teaching honors while continuing to write journal articles, books, plays, and two novels that support the teaching of general psychology and statistics.
